Notes
- Description
-
Four men, leaning on stools at shelf in front of wall of mail in cubbyholes, sorting mail, with tables at left and hanging lamps at top
Probably related to Los Angeles Times article, April 28, 1934, "Beverly Hills Fete Today, Dedication of New Postoffice Will Be Followed by Many Other Events of Festival."
